What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in Woodford County?

All work must be permitted through the Woodford County Zoning and Planning Department and performed by a contractor licensed by the IDFPR. The 2021 IRC with Illinois amendments now mandates specific ice and water shield application in eaves and valleys, along with step flashing offsets at wall intersections. These code-prescribed details are non-negotiable for passing inspection and ensuring the roof assembly performs as an integrated system.

I have new shingles but my attic is moldy. Could the roof be the problem?

Absolutely. A 4/12 pitch roof like many in Cruger requires a balanced ventilation system per the 2021 IRC. Improper intake at the soffits or exhaust at the ridge leads to heat and moisture buildup. This trapped humidity condenses on the roof sheathing, promoting mold growth and reducing the effectiveness of your insulation, which can be mistaken for a leaking roof.

What makes a roof 'storm-proof' for our high winds and hail?

Storm resilience here is defined by code and material science. Cruger is in a 115 mph wind zone (ASCE 7-22), requiring enhanced shingle sealing and decking attachment. Given our high hail risk, specifying Class 4 impact-resistant shingles is a financial necessity for the April-June storm season. These shingles are engineered to withstand 2-inch hail strikes, drastically reducing the likelihood of insurance claims for cosmetic and functional damage.

My roof looks fine from the ground. Why would I need a professional inspection?

Visual inspections from the ground or a ladder often miss critical sub-surface failure. Limited drone usage allows for a detailed survey of the entire field, identifying subtle granule loss, early-stage blistering, and moisture infiltration beneath the shingle layer that signals decking compromise. This diagnostic approach finds problems a traditional walk-over might miss until a leak becomes evident inside your home.

Should I install traditional shingles or wait for solar shingles?

The decision hinges on priorities. Traditional architectural shingles offer proven storm resilience and lower upfront cost. Solar shingles integrate energy generation, leveraging Cruger's 1:1 net metering and the 30% federal tax credit. For 2026, if your primary goal is maximizing durability against hail and wind, traditional Class 4 shingles are the advised choice. If reducing your energy bill is the paramount goal, a solar-ready roof system or integrated solar may be justified.
